or you can just use itunes 7.4
convert a song to .wav, edit it in basic windows sound recorder.
then take the .wav file you edited and convert it to .m4a (i use imTOO mpeg converter, it converts to any type of file) then just go into explorer and change the m4a to .m4r and drag it into itunes.
Sounds like a lot typed but its really not at all. i made all my ringers like that and synced them to my phone
